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Monterey to Sausalito is to drive which costs $21 - $35 and takes 2h 24m.
The fastest way to get from Monterey to Sausalito is to drive which takes 2h 24m and costs $21 - $35.
No, there is no direct bus from Monterey to Sausalito. However, there are services departing from Tyler / Franklin and arriving at Bridgeway & Turney St via Salinas, San Jose Diridon Station and Salesforce Transit Center-Bus Plaza Bay A.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h 31m.
The distance between Monterey and Sausalito is 104 miles. The road distance is 120.5 miles.
